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$235.51 | 3.289% | $243.2559 | $243.26 | $243.25 | $243.30 |
Purchase #2 | $128.80 | 5.460% | $135.8325 | $135.83 | $135.85 | $135.80 |
Purchase #3 | $77.94 | 13.656% | $88.5835 | $88.58 | $88.60 | $88.60 |
Purchase #4 | $213.88 | 12.532% | $240.6834 | $240.68 | $240.70 | $240.70 |
Purchase #5 | $19.44 | 9.138% | $21.2164 | $21.22 | $21.20 | $21.20 |
Purchase #6 | $18.97 | 5.284% | $19.9724 | $19.97 | $19.95 | $20.00 |
Purchase #7 | $124.42 | 8.587% | $135.1039 | $135.10 | $135.10 | $135.10 |
7 purchase totals = | $818.96 | $884.6480 | $884.64 | $884.65 | $884.70 |
